Monitoring Dynamic Characteristics for a Supertall Structure under Construction
The Guangzhou New TV Tower (GNTVT) which has just completed its construction in May 2009 in Guangzhou, China, is a super tall tube-in-tube structure with a total height of 618m. A complicated structural health monitoring (SHM) system consisting of over 700 sensors has being implemented to the GNTVT for both in-construction and inservice real-time monitoring. This paper will introduce the field vibration measurement and present the results of the field vibration measurements under different construction phases and different conditions. The identified results are compared both with GPS measurements and those obtained from the finite element model. The dependency of the identified modal properties on environmental factors is also investigated. The results of this paper supply some references for better understanding the dynamic characteristics of supertall and slender structures.
